Rhino-NC is a 3D CAM software for CNC machines and robot programming. This solution is really easy and quick to learn; on any kind of machine, high speed, multi-function, old CNC, Rhino-NC is extremely flexible and really powerful to ensure effective programming and performance. Rhino-NC 's fields of applications are: mechanical, toolmaking, mould industry, modelling and prototyping, shipyards, petrochemical industries, etc.

Curve, surface, solid


This version of Rhino-NC allows to manage the machining either on curves, surfaces and solids. The software comes complete with several libraries like "Tools Archive" and "Machines Archive" which can be updated and customized by the user. The graphic interface is based on wizard with text fields and related images. It allows a simple and intuitive input of the different parameters to control each strategy, with graphic dynamic help, varying the displayed images on the basis of selected parameter. .


Machining Tree: The Easiest way of Use

RhinoNC is extremely easy to use, due to its innovative machining tree strategy. So the user is operative in a very short time and without complex and expensive trainings. It is possible to create an array of machinings, modify them, copy or rearrange the sequence of processing.

AMM

The advanced multi-axis machining module, provides new machining strategies for an advanced use of the multi-axis technology (4 o 5), thanks to the increased accuracy and fluency of the toolpath generation it's possible to reduce machining times.
Cinematic Simulation


The generated toolpath can be simulated inside Rhinoceros using the cinematic simulation with full collision detection. The cinematic simulation considers the upload of the full CNC, of the equipment and the piece to be machined. This offers the ability to create toolpaths avoiding any risk of wrong positioning and to be ready for the production. Simple management of multi-axis post-processing once the CNC cinematic has been set up. The output file for the machine tools is managed by postprocessors fully user-definable by means of a simple text editor.
